The Client
Queen Mary’s College is an incorporated, co-educational, sixth form college based in Basingstoke. The college had a requirement to relocate several of their departments to a newly constructed building on the other side of their campus.
The Project
Queen Mary’s College chose Cube Relocations to provide a relocation solution that was built around their bespoke requirements. The solution would enable the relocation of approximately 100 staff members and the equipment required to deliver teaching to 1200 students. Wrapping, packing, uplift, removal and unpacking of all these items would form key components of the solution that Cube Relocations delivered.
The Process
As the departments being moved included science, physical education, geography, psychology and history, the work required the relocation of sensitive items such as computer equipment and potentially hazardous chemicals. Cube Relocations risk assessed the new environment and the nature of the items that needed to be relocated; and recommended an effective solution which included appropriate packaging and waste transfer notes.
In order to ensure that the move would be delivered according to the required timescales, the move management team at Cube Relocations put together a detailed project delivery plan that would allow for the items to be appropriately packaged, taking into account the time needed to build bespoke packaging. The items would also need to be moved and unpacked as quickly as possible so that the college could be fully functioning with little disruption to the services that they provide to their students.
